AccessTr.neT

Tam Versiyon: Xlm Kodu
Şu anda arşiv modunu görüntülemektesiniz. Tam versiyonu görüntülemek için buraya tıklayınız.
Merhaba,
USysRibbons adlı tabloda aşağıdaki XLM kodları var bu kodlar ribon şerit oluşturuyor.

Kod:
<customUI xmlns="http://schemas.microsoft.com/office/2009/07/customui" onLoad="OnRibbonLoad" loadImage="LoadImages">
<ribbon startFromScratch="true">
  <tabs>
      <tab id="tabyeni79" label="Apartman Yönetim">
    <group id="grpyeni79" label="Yönetim Yapısı">
      <menu id="menu4"  label="Yönetim Bilgileri" itemSize="large"  size="large"  imageMso = "FileSendMenu">

        <button id="btnm460313" label="Yönetim" imageMso = "WordArtEditTextClassic" onAction="DugmeOlaylari"  />
        <button id="btnm395114" label="Bloklar" imageMso = "BlogHomePage" onAction="DugmeOlaylari"  />
        <button id="btnm916314" label="Bağımsız Bölüm Sahipleri" imageMso = "EditBusinessCard"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Yönetim Bilgileri) -->


      </group>
    <group id="grp16" label="Harcama Tanım">
      <menu id="menu14"  label="Harcama Türleri" itemSize="large"  size="large"  imageMso = "DatabaseEncodeDecode">

        <button id="btnm882512" label="Harcama Tür Giriş" imageMso = "ReadingViewShowPrintedPage"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Harcama Türleri) -->


      </group>
    <group id="grp17" label="Gelirler">
      <menu id="menu16"  label="Ödemeler Giriş" itemSize="large"  size="large"  imageMso = "MailMergeRecipientsEditList">

        <button id="btnm386611" label="Gelir/Ödeme" imageMso = "MoveToFolder"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Ödemeler Giriş) -->


      </group>
    <group id="grp18" label="Giderler">
      <menu id="menu17"  label="Harcama Giriş" itemSize="large"  size="large"  imageMso = "SmartArtResetGraphic">

        <button id="btnm144812" label="Gider/Harcama" imageMso = "MailMergeFinishAndMergeMenu"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Harcama Giriş) -->


      </group>
    <group id="grp19" label="Raporlar">
      <menu id="menu18"  label="Rapor" itemSize="large"  size="large"  imageMso = "FileWorkflowTasks">

        <button id="btnm155617" label="Gelir Takip" imageMso = "SmartArtAddShapeAfter" onAction="DugmeOlaylari"  />
        <button id="btnm686513" label="Gider Takip" imageMso = "ZoomCurrent100" onAction="DugmeOlaylari"  />
        <button id="btnm376516" label="Gelir/Gider Sonuç" imageMso = "ZoomToSelection"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Rapor) -->


      <separator id="separator20"/>

      <button id="btn19" size="large" label="Çıkış" imageMso = "PrintPreviewClose" onAction="DugmeOlaylari"  />

      </group>

     </tab>

  </tabs>
</ribbon>
Bu XLM koduda Accessin dosya menüsünü gizliyor

Kod:
<customUI xmlns="http://schemas.microsoft.com/office/2009/07/customui">

<!-- *** TAG COMMANDS  ***-->
<commands>
   <command idMso="Help" enabled = "false"/>
</commands>

<ribbon startFromScratch="true"/>

<!-- *** BACKSTAGE ***-->

<backstage>
<button idMso="FileSave" visible="false"/>
<button idMso="SaveObjectAs" visible="false"/>
<button idMso="FileSaveAsCurrentFileFormat" visible="false"/>
<button idMso="FileOpen" visible="false"/>
<button idMso="FileCloseDatabase" visible="false"/>
<tab idMso ="TabInfo" visible="false"/>
<tab idMso ="TabRecent" visible="false"/>
<tab idMso ="TabNew" visible="false"/>
<tab idMso ="TabPrint" visible="false"/>
<tab idMso ="TabShare" visible="false"/>
<tab idMso ="TabHelp" visible="false"/>
<button idMso="ApplicationOptionsDialog" visible="false"/>
<button idMso="FileExit" visible="false"/>
</backstage>

</customUI>
sorum bu iki kodu tek bir kod olarak nasıl birleştirilir.
Saygılarımla
Merhaba, iki kod birleştirildiğinde çalışacağını sanmıyorum ama,

<customUI xmlns="http://schemas.microsoft.com/office/2009/07/customui" onLoad="OnRibbonLoad" loadImage="LoadImages">
<ribbon startFromScratch="true">
<tabs>
<tab id="tabyeni79" label="Apartman Yönetim">
<group id="grpyeni79" label="Yönetim Yapısı">
<menu id="menu4"  label="Yönetim Bilgileri" itemSize="large"  size="large"  imageMso = "FileSendMenu">
<button id="btnm460313" label="Yönetim" imageMso = "WordArtEditTextClassic" onAction="DugmeOlaylari" />
<button id="btnm395114" label="Bloklar" imageMso = "BlogHomePage" onAction="DugmeOlaylari"  />
<button id="btnm916314" label="Bağımsız Bölüm Sahipleri" imageMso = "EditBusinessCard" onAction="DugmeOlaylari"  />
</menu>

<!--Ana Menü Kapandı.. (Yönetim Bilgileri) -->
</group>
<group id="grp16" label="Harcama Tanım">
<menu id="menu14"  label="Harcama Türleri" itemSize="large"  size="large"  imageMso = "DatabaseEncodeDecode">
<button id="btnm882512" label="Harcama Tür Giriş" imageMso = "ReadingViewShowPrintedPage"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Harcama Türleri) -->
</group>
<group id="grp17" label="Gelirler">
<menu id="menu16"  label="Ödemeler Giriş" itemSize="large"  size="large"  imageMso = "MailMergeRecipientsEditList">
<button id="btnm386611" label="Gelir/Ödeme" imageMso = "MoveToFolder"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Ödemeler Giriş) -->
</group>
<group id="grp18" label="Giderler">
<menu id="menu17"  label="Harcama Giriş" itemSize="large"  size="large"  imageMso = "SmartArtResetGraphic">
<button id="btnm144812" label="Gider/Harcama" imageMso = "MailMergeFinishAndMergeMenu"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Harcama Giriş) -->
</group>
<group id="grp19" label="Raporlar">
<menu id="menu18"  label="Rapor" itemSize="large"  size="large"  imageMso = "FileWorkflowTasks">
<button id="btnm155617" label="Gelir Takip" imageMso = "SmartArtAddShapeAfter" onAction="DugmeOlaylari"  />
<button id="btnm686513" label="Gider Takip" imageMso = "ZoomCurrent100" onAction="DugmeOlaylari"  />
<button id="btnm376516" label="Gelir/Gider Sonuç" imageMso = "ZoomToSelection"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Rapor) -->
<separator id="separator20"/>
<button id="btn19" size="large" label="Çıkış" imageMso = "PrintPreviewClose" onAction="DugmeOlaylari"  />
</group>

</tab>

</tabs>
</ribbon>

<commands>
<command idMso="Help" enabled = "false"/>
</commands>

<backstage>
<button idMso="FileSave" visible="false"/>
<button idMso="SaveObjectAs" visible="false"/>
<button idMso="FileSaveAsCurrentFileFormat" visible="false"/>
<button idMso="FileOpen" visible="false"/>
<button idMso="FileCloseDatabase" visible="false"/>
<tab idMso ="TabInfo" visible="false"/>
<tab idMso ="TabRecent" visible="false"/>
<tab idMso ="TabNew" visible="false"/>
<tab idMso ="TabPrint" visible="false"/>
<tab idMso ="TabShare" visible="false"/>
<tab idMso ="TabHelp" visible="false"/>
<button idMso="ApplicationOptionsDialog" visible="false"/>
<button idMso="FileExit" visible="false"/>
</backstage>

</customUI>

Şeklinde deneyin. Çalışmaz ise örneğinizi ekleyin, birde örnek üzerinden deneyelim.
Merhaba,

Hocam evet dediğiniz gibi çalışmadı. Program açılınca apartman yönetimi adlı ribon aktif oluyor. Yapmak İstediğim, program açılınca apartman yönetimi adlı ribonla beraber, accessin dosya menüsünü pasif eden xlm kodu da beraber devreye girmesi. 
Teşekkür ederim
Saygılarımla.
<customUI xmlns="http://schemas.microsoft.com/office/2009/07/customui">
<ribbon startFromScratch="true">



  <tabs>
<tab id="tabyeni79" label="Apartman Yönetim">
<group id="grpyeni79" label="Yönetim Yapısı">
<menu id="menu4"  label="Yönetim Bilgileri" itemSize="large"  size="large"  imageMso = "FileSendMenu">
<button id="btnm460313" label="Yönetim" imageMso = "WordArtEditTextClassic" onAction="DugmeOlaylari" />
<button id="btnm395114" label="Bloklar" imageMso = "BlogHomePage" onAction="DugmeOlaylari"  />
<button id="btnm916314" label="Bağımsız Bölüm Sahipleri" imageMso = "EditBusinessCard" onAction="DugmeOlaylari"  />
</menu>

<!--Ana Menü Kapandı.. (Yönetim Bilgileri) -->
</group>
<group id="grp16" label="Harcama Tanım">
<menu id="menu14"  label="Harcama Türleri" itemSize="large"  size="large"  imageMso = "DatabaseEncodeDecode">
<button id="btnm882512" label="Harcama Tür Giriş" imageMso = "ReadingViewShowPrintedPage"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Harcama Türleri) -->
</group>
<group id="grp17" label="Gelirler">
<menu id="menu16"  label="Ödemeler Giriş" itemSize="large"  size="large"  imageMso = "MailMergeRecipientsEditList">
<button id="btnm386611" label="Gelir/Ödeme" imageMso = "MoveToFolder"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Ödemeler Giriş) -->
</group>
<group id="grp18" label="Giderler">
<menu id="menu17"  label="Harcama Giriş" itemSize="large"  size="large"  imageMso = "SmartArtResetGraphic">
<button id="btnm144812" label="Gider/Harcama" imageMso = "MailMergeFinishAndMergeMenu"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Harcama Giriş) -->
</group>
<group id="grp19" label="Raporlar">
<menu id="menu18"  label="Rapor" itemSize="large"  size="large"  imageMso = "FileWorkflowTasks">
<button id="btnm155617" label="Gelir Takip" imageMso = "SmartArtAddShapeAfter" onAction="DugmeOlaylari"  />
<button id="btnm686513" label="Gider Takip" imageMso = "ZoomCurrent100" onAction="DugmeOlaylari"  />
<button id="btnm376516" label="Gelir/Gider Sonuç" imageMso = "ZoomToSelection" onAction="DugmeOlaylari"  />
</menu>
<!--Ana Menü Kapandı.. (Rapor) -->
<separator id="separator20"/>
<button id="btn19" size="large" label="Çıkış" imageMso = "PrintPreviewClose" onAction="DugmeOlaylari"  />
</group>

</tab>

</tabs>



  </ribbon>

<backstage>
        <button idMso="FileCloseDatabase" visible="false"/>
        <button idMso="SaveObjectAs" visible="false"/>
        <button idMso="FileSaveAsCurrentFileFormat" visible="false"/>
        <button idMso="FileOpen" visible="false"/>
        <button idMso="FileSave" visible="false"/>
        <tab idMso ="TabInfo" visible="false"/>
        <tab idMso="TabRecent" visible="false"/>
        <tab idMso="TabNew" visible="false"/>
        <tab idMso="TabPrint" visible="false"/>
        <tab idMso="TabShare" visible="false"/>
        <tab idMso="TabHelp" visible="false"/>
        <button idMso="ApplicationOptionsDialog" visible="false"/>
        <button idMso="FileExit" visible="false"/>
</backstage>
</customUI>



şeklinde dener misin ?
Merhaba,
sn.userx, elinize sağlık çok teşekkür ederim istediğim gibi oldu.
Saygılarımla.